Halloween (1978)
Finest to not maintain Halloween answerable for the various, many imitators that received all of it flawed: The slasher style that this movie helped to solidify rapidly grew to become laughably sexually conservative in a “intercourse = loss of life” kinda means, however that wasn’t this film’s message. Director John Carpenter wrote many of the scary stuff, however late, nice producer Debra Hill wrote every little thing involving Laurie Strode (Jamie Lee Curtis) and her pals. When Lynda (P.J. Soles) and Bob (John Michael Graham) have intercourse and get killed, the one intent was to point out teenagers doing regular teen stuff. They have been meant to be relatable, not sinners getting what was coming to them. You’ll be able to stream Halloween on AMC+ and Shudder or hire it from Prime Video.
Certain (1996)
The intercourse scenes between ex-con Corky (Gina Gershon) and Mafia moll Violet (Jennifer Tilly) are as sensual and erotic as they arrive, sidestepping then- and still-common cinematic lesbian tropes in favor of real sexiness. Nothing right here feels prefer it’s strictly meant for the straight white gaze, though the film toys with that notion within the methods the connection between the 2 girls eggs on the very straight male insecurities of mobster Caesar (Joe Pantoliano). The Wachowskis employed feminist writer and intercourse educator Susie Vivid (who has a cameo within the film) as an intimacy coordinator earlier than that job even had a reputation. The completed product makes a really robust case that having somebody round who understands intercourse and intimacy does’t put a damper on issues; fairly the alternative. The Watermelon Lady (1996)
It was the intercourse scene that each one however broke the Nationwide Endowment for the Arts. Cheryl Dunye performs herself on this faux-documentary following a filmmaker trying to unearth the story of the “Watermelon Lady,” a fictional Black actress from the early days of Hollywood. Genevieve Turner performs Diana, a extra overtly assured white girl who flirts with Cheryl as a buyer of the video retailer the place she works. This results in a candy, but in addition steamy intercourse scene, described by Metropolis Paper reviewer Jeannine DeLombard as “the most popular dyke intercourse scene on celluloid”—a little bit of an exaggeration, but it surely’s up there, whereas additionally being a key second of private development for the sometimes-awkward Cheryl.
That blurb made its means to conservative columnist Julia Duin, who decried the movie sight-unseen, demanding to know why taxpayers have been spending cash on lesbian filth (I am certain that the characters’ blended pores and skin tones had nothing to do with it). The talk made all of it the best way to the ground in Congress, the place politicians tried to claw again the manufacturing’s $31,000 grant. They in the end settled on a restructuring of this system in order that grants may go solely to particular tasks, moderately than organizations.
